vujade January 23rd 2004 09:15

well guys, I think that I agree with most of you and think that they look way better on my bug. I just wasnt sure how they would look on the Fasty until I swapped them on. Then once i did it, I didnt really like it.

I think personally that a set of 16 x 7 Fuchs woulds look so much nicer.
Or even as Brendan suggested a set of 16" Phone Dials.

Not sure yet, have to do more research.

BTW Brendan, I dont need an adjustable beam for my T3.
T3 front ends are already adjustable from the factory.

zen January 24th 2004 19:55

1 Attachment(s)
i have to agree with everyone else. they are OK, but others would be much better.

my black Ronals are up for sale (just haven't posted them yet) if you want to consider them. they are low offset for the deep look. already have Kumho's on them. 16x7ET11 and 16x8ET23 (i may have the offsets backwards) with 195/50 and 225/50 (cause they were going on the bug, stock 951 is 205/55 in the front).

i attached a not so good pic of one. tires haven't been treated yet and the rim is pretty dusty from the move, but you get the idea.
